Retail Excellence Programme

Five more Norfolk towns can now take advantage of the Retail Excellence Programme which has been extended to businesses based in Gorleston, Hunstanton, Attleborough, Aylsham and Sheringham, who can sign up for six free workshops to develop and enhance the skills needed for a modern retail business to thrive.

The workshops aim to develop skills and increase footfall while fostering a stronger sense of community and encouraging innovation and future retail collaborations.

Rural towns are pivotal to Norfolk’s economic prosperity and High Streets Matter was launched to help equip businesses for success and help high streets to flourish. Delivered by High Streets Matter, the Retail Excellence Programme is designed for anyone running, or working in, a retail environment, such as a traditional shop, market stall, farm shop, or an online retailer looking to move into physical premises.

Shape the future workforce of Norfolk

The Norfolk and Suffolk Careers Hub, a partnership between The Careers and Enterprise Company, Norfolk County Council and Suffolk County Council, exists to make sure young people have the skills and confidence to step into the world of work, training or future education, and Norfolk businesses are a vital part of that journey.

The Careers Hub team works with schools, colleges, apprenticeship providers and businesses to connect education with real-world opportunities.

Here’s how you can make an impact:

Become an Enterprise Advisor – Partner with a local school or college, share your workplace experiences and inspire the next generation to raise their aspirations and build essential skills.

Host a Teacher Encounter – Give teachers a first-hand look into your industry so they can link classroom learning to career pathways and opportunities.

Offer Workplace Experiences – From site visits to employer-led projects, give young people a taste of the workplace and help them see where their ambitions could take them.

Your time, knowledge and insight could spark a young person’s career journey and help build and bolster Norfolk’s talent pipeline.
